About Crawl4AI
Crawl4AI is an open source web crawler and scraper designed to prepare website content for large language model (LLM) workflows. It lives in the Python ecosystem and targets data extraction for RAG, agents, and AI pipelines. Unlike many tools that require API keys or paid subscriptions, Crawl4AI provides direct, self hosted access to web content with output structured specifically for LLM consumption.

About single-file-cli
SingleFile CLI (Command Line Interface) Introduction SingleFile can be launched from the command line by running it into a (headless) browser. It runs through Deno as a standalone script injected into the web page via the Chrome DevTools Protocol, or via WebDriver BiDi when using Firefox, instead of being embedded into a WebExtension. Installation SingleFile can be run without installing it, just download the executable file and save it in the directory of your choice here: Make sure Chrome or a Chromium based browser is installed in the default folder.
